Subdromomeryx antilopinus
Taxonomy
Blastomeryx antilopinus was named by Scott (1893) [also said to be 1893].
It was recombined as Palaeomeryx antilopinus by Douglass (1899) and Matthew (1904); it was recombined as Dromomeryx antilopinus by Douglass (1909), Scott (1913), Frick (1937) and Janis and Manning (1998); it was recombined as Subdromomeryx antilopinus by Prothero and Liter (2007) and Prothero and Liter (2008).

Diagnosis
Reference | Diagnosis | |
---|---|---|
W. B. Scott 1893 | Size decidedly smaller than that of B. borealis Cope, and ribs of external crescents on upper molars less prominent. | |
D. R. Prothero and M. R. Liter 2008 | Similar to Dromomeryx, but much smaller size (Table
1; Fig. 10); molars more mesodont; premolar row shorter, and Palaeomeryx fold usually lost. Supraorbital horns relatively smaller, with basal flange less pronounced, and limbs relatively longer and more slender than those of Dromomeryx (after Janis and Manning, 1998, p. 483). |
